Business Analyst Intern - Summer 2026

BerkleyNet is an innovative workers compensation insurance provider focused on online business solutions. The Business Analyst Intern will assist in evaluating business systems and operational processes, collaborating with cross-functional teams to identify opportunities for innovation and implement solutions.

Responsibilities

As a Business Analyst Intern, you will be assisting the Business Analyst group as a liaison between stakeholders and technology partners to review, analyze and evaluate business systems, operational processes and customer needs to identify opportunities for innovation and collaborate with cross-functional teams to create and implement solutions
Administrative tasks involving issue submissions through Atlassian software
User acceptance testing and guide creation
Collaborate with end users and stakeholders to assist in development and translation of business requirements for project and supporting deliverables
Suggest changes to business stakeholders using data and analytics to support recommendations
Manage workload by balancing competing priorities
Conduct meetings or presentations informing the business on progress within tasks/projects assigned
Effectively communicate insights and plans to cross-functional team members and management
Identifies issues and investigate the scope of the issue
Participate in cross functional project teams as determined by management

Qualification

Microsoft SQLExcelRelational database conceptsAnalytical skillsCustomer service skillsAttention to detailDocumentation skillsOrganization skills

Required

Microsoft SQL and Excel experience and proficiency strongly preferred
Familiar with relational database concepts and client-server concepts
Attention to detail
Strong documentation skills
Analytical and quantitative skills
Strong discretion in dealing with confidential and sensitive information
Organization, prioritization and customer service skills to effectively follow-up on complex and detailed work activities
Experience with setting delivery commitments and meeting expectations
Relevant field of study and/or equivalent project experience
Low level of domestic U.S. travel required (up to 5% of time)
